Output 6da8786e4e410c02cfb79c4ac34f86712a7daa5e714e0dbc0967913f5d1b9477:0

value
24853149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 621cc71baf9224faffa810284ee923b2ec92f104 OP_EQUAL
address
MGqvvk6TcTQnPb4FMLNtZozqBUquBuT7Fw
transaction
6da8786e4e410c02cfb79c4ac34f86712a7daa5e714e0dbc0967913f5d1b9477
spent
true